About 7 Hampton Cottages

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

7 Hampton Cottages is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Maplehurst, Horsham, Horsham (RH13 6RE). It has a recorded floor area of 63 m² (around 678 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(September 2019) shows an E (score 52),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. When first surveyed in June 2015 the rating was F,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Average to Good, window efficiency went from Poor to Average and h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or; while main heating dropped from Average to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 88), a 3-band jump. Main heating runs on electricity. Other recorded features include outbuildings. Period features are noted in the property record.

At 63 m² it sits well below the postcode median (134 m² across 13 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. Across 2015–2021, sale prices on this property compounded at 2.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£449,000 is 23%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£538/sq ft) was about 74.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old September 2021 for £365,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
